A great starting point was a reminder of the definition of Glycemic Index. The GI compares equal quantities of available carbohydrate in foods, is a measure of their effect on blood glucose levels in 10+ healthy people over a 2 hour period, and is expressed as a percentage.
The GI Ranking (as I hope you do know since we’re always on the lookout for the low ones) for individual foods looks like this:
- Low = 55 or less
- Moderate = 56-69
- High = 70+
I also liked the example of an apple he provided in his definition of Glycemic Load (GL):
“A function of a food’s glycemic index and its total available carbohydrate content and defined as:
Glycemic Load = GI (%) x Carbohydrate (g)
Using an apple (140g with skin and core): GI value = 38%; Carbohydrate per serve =15 g
GL = 0.38 x 15 = 6
The GL of a medium sized (140g) apple is 6. Don’t you love how easy that is to work out??
It’s important to remember that the higher the GL, the greater the elevation in blood glucose AND insulin levels, so it’s worth keeping an eye on.
As already mentioned, both the amount and type of carbs are important predictors of blood glucose levels but something that I hadn’t specifically talked about is that together they account for 90% of the total variability in blood glucose response.
Dr Barclay then ran through a number of studies that demonstrated benefits as outlined in that first blog of mine, including an extra couple worth mentioning here:
- There was Grade A (the best) evidence to show that for those of us at risk of hypoglycaemia, those people who favoured low-GI carbs had significantly fewer hypos than those who didn’t.
- Research demonstrating that low GI foods tip the balance in favour of fat oxidation (meaning you’ll burn fat rather than store it)
- In terms of weight maintenance, one study, a randomised controlled trial called Diogenes, showed that people on a Low-GI higher protein diet were able to maintain their weight loss where all the other ‘diets’ led to weight regain over a 6 month period.

You know of the GI Symbol, but were you aware of what the requirements are to be able to display the symbol on packaging?
- Products must be tested by approved laboratory using the Australian Standard procedure.
- Products must contain greater than or equal to 10g of carbohydrate, or greater than or equal to 80% carbohydrate AND be traditionally served in multiple units of small serve sizes
- Products must meet strict nutrition criteria (all the things we’re looking for with diabetes!):
- Energy
- Total and Saturated Fat
- Sodium
- Dietary Fibre
- Calcium
